Security Vulnerabilities in Java Runtime Environment May Allow Network Access Restrictions to be Circumvented
1. Impact
[1] A vulnerability in the Java Runtime Environment (JRE) may allow malicious Javascript code that is downloaded by a browser from a malicious website to make network connections, through Java APIs, to network services on machines other than the one that the Javascript code was downloaded from. This may allow network resources (such as web pages) and vulnerabilities (that exist on these network services) which are not otherwise normally accessible to be accessed or exploited.
[2] A second vulnerability in the JRE may allow an untrusted applet that is downloaded from a malicious website through a web proxy to make network connections to network services on machines other than the one that the applet was downloaded from. This may allow network resources (such as web pages) and vulnerabilities (that exist on these network services) which are not otherwise normally accessible to be accessed or exploited.

Sun acknowledges with thanks, Dan Boneh, Collin Jackson, Adam Barth, Andrew Bortz, Weidong Shao, and David Byrne for bringing these issues to our attention.
2. Contributing Factors
The first issue can occur in the following releases (for Windows, Solaris, and Linux running the Firefox and Opera browsers):
- JDK and JRE 6 Update 2 and earlier
- JDK and JRE 5.0 Update 12 and earlier
- SDK and JRE 1.4.2_15 and earlier
- SDK and JRE 1.3.1_20 and earlier
Note: This issue does not affect the Internet Explorer browser.
The second issue can occur in the following releases (for Windows, Solaris, and Linux):
- JDK and JRE 6 Update 2 and earlier
- JDK and JRE 5.0 Update 12 and earlier
- SDK and JRE 1.4.2_15 and earlier
- SDK and JRE 1.3.1_20 and earlier
To determine the default version of the JRE that Internet Explorer uses:
- Click "Tools" in the Menu Bar at the top of the browser
- Select "Sun Java Console"
- The first two lines in the console displays the version of Java Plug-in and JRE that Internet Explorer uses
To determine the default version of the JRE that Mozilla or Firefox browsers use, visit the URL "about:plugins".
The browser will display a page called "Installed plug-ins" which lists the version of the Java Plug-in such as the following:
Java(TM) Plug-in 1.5.0_11-b03
This above example indicates that the version of the JRE that the browser uses is 1.5.0_11.

4. Workaround
Several options to mitigate the risk of these vulnerabilities are documented in the Stanford DNS Rebinding paper referenced above. The options include modifying browsers, configuring DNS servers and firewalls. More details are available in the paper at the URL above (please see the Impact Statement).
5. Resolution
Sun has included changes that perform additional hostname matching using DNS reverse mapping data to mitigate these issues. We are working with industry partners to more fully address these issues and will include additional improvements in later update releases.
[1] Mitigations for the first issue are included in the following releases (for Windows, Solaris and Linux):
- JDK and JRE 6 Update 3 and later
- JDK and JRE 5.0 Update 13 and later
- SDK and JRE 1.4.2_16 and later
and are included in the following release (for Windows and Solaris 8):
- SDK and JRE 1.3.1_21 and later
[2] Migitations for the second issue are included in the following releases (for Windows, Solaris, and Linux):
- JDK and JRE 6 Update 3 and later
- JDK and JRE 5.0 Update 13 and later
and are included in later releases of SDK and JRE 1.4.2 and 1.3.1.
